A portable fridge is a versatile and convenient solution for keeping your food and drinks cold on the go. When choosing one, you’ll want to take into account factors like cooling speed, power draw, and packing options. These aspects directly impact how well your portable fridge performs and how easy it is to use during your trips. One of the key features to look for is battery efficiency. A model with good battery efficiency ensures that you can run it longer without constantly needing to recharge or replace batteries, which is especially important if you’re off-grid or on a long journey. Efficient energy use not only prolongs your power supply but also helps keep your overall setup lightweight, saving you from hauling around heavy extra batteries or power sources. Along with battery efficiency, temperature stability is vital. A fridge that maintains a consistent internal temperature prevents food spoilage and ensures your drinks stay perfectly chilled. Good temperature stability means your fridge adjusts to external temperature fluctuations smoothly, avoiding sudden spikes or drops that could compromise your stored items. Additionally, some models feature advanced temperature controls that make it easier to set and monitor precise temperatures, further enhancing food safety and energy efficiency. Incorporating temperature regulation technology can significantly improve your overall experience by keeping your food fresh for longer periods.

Cooling speed varies among different models, which influences how quickly your food and beverages reach your desired temperature. If you’re in a rush, look for fridges with rapid cooling capabilities. However, keep in mind that faster cooling might sometimes lead to higher power consumption, so balance your needs accordingly. When it comes to power draw, a lower energy consumption model is generally more practical, especially if you’re relying on a limited power source like a battery or solar panel. Many portable fridges feature adjustable temperature settings, allowing you to optimize power use without sacrificing performance. Additionally, understanding power efficiency can help you select a model that best suits your energy constraints. A well-designed insulation system is essential for maintaining internal temperatures and reducing overall energy consumption. Good insulation not only improves temperature stability but also extends cooling duration, making your fridge more reliable during extended trips. Proper insulation also minimizes the need for frequent adjustments, conserving your power resources and ensuring steady performance. How Long Does a Portable Fridge Keep Food Cold Without Power?

A portable fridge can keep your food cold for about 8 to 12 hours without power, depending on insulation quality and ambient temperature. To maximize energy efficiency and extend cooling time, you should pre-chill the fridge before power loss and minimize opening it. Good power management guarantees your food stays fresh longer, especially during emergencies or power outages. Keep these tips in mind for better performance and longer cooling periods.

What Are the Best Battery Options for Portable Fridges?

The best battery options for portable fridges are high-capacity lithium-ion batteries because they offer excellent power efficiency and long-lasting battery capacity. Look for batteries with at least 100Ah capacity for extended use, especially if you’re off-grid. Solar-compatible batteries can also boost efficiency and sustainability. Make sure your choice matches your fridge’s power draw to prevent quick depletion, and always consider portability and charging options for convenience.

How Do Ambient Temperatures Affect Cooling Performance?

Ambient temperature impact can be dramatic—if it’s scorching hot outside, your portable fridge might struggle to keep things icy, while freezing conditions can actually overwork it. These temperature swings directly influence cooling efficiency, making your fridge work harder or less effectively. To keep your food fresh, be aware of these effects and position your fridge wisely, especially in extreme weather, to maintain ideal cooling performance.
